When it comes to electrical wiring, choosing the right wire size is crucial for ensuring safe and efficient transmission of electricity. A wire sizing chart is a valuable tool that helps electricians and DIY enthusiasts determine the appropriate wire size for their specific needs. In this article, we will explore the key aspects of wire sizing charts and what you need to know to make informed decisions.
1. Understanding Wire Gauge
The wire gauge is a critical factor in determining the wire size, and it refers to the diameter of the wire. The American Wire Gauge (AWG) system is the standard used in North America, and it assigns a gauge number to each wire size. The lower the gauge number, the larger the wire diameter, and vice versa. Understanding wire gauge is essential for selecting the right wire size for your electrical project.
2. Wire Material and Type
Different wire materials and types have varying resistance levels, which affect the wire sizing chart. Copper wire, for example, is a popular choice due to its high conductivity and relatively low cost. Aluminum wire, on the other hand, is lighter and less expensive but has a higher resistance level. The type of wire insulation and jacketing also plays a role in determining the wire size.
3. Voltage and Current Ratings
The voltage and current ratings of the electrical circuit are critical factors in determining the wire size. Higher voltage and current ratings require larger wire sizes to prevent overheating and ensure safe transmission of electricity. The wire sizing chart takes into account the voltage and current ratings to provide the recommended wire size.
4. Wire Length and Run
The length of the wire run and the number of connections also impact the wire sizing chart. Longer wire runs and multiple connections increase the resistance and voltage drop, requiring larger wire sizes to compensate. The wire sizing chart helps you determine the minimum wire size required to maintain a safe and efficient electrical circuit.
5. Ambient Temperature
Ambient temperature is another factor that affects the wire sizing chart. Higher temperatures increase the resistance of the wire, requiring larger wire sizes to prevent overheating. The wire sizing chart takes into account the ambient temperature to provide the recommended wire size for your specific environment.
6. Conductor Insulation and Jacketing
The type and thickness of conductor insulation and jacketing also impact the wire sizing chart. Thicker insulation and jacketing increase the wire diameter, affecting the wire size. The wire sizing chart considers the insulation and jacketing types to provide the recommended wire size.
7. Bundling and Conduit Fill
Bundling multiple wires together and filling conduits with wires increase the heat generation and resistance. The wire sizing chart accounts for bundling and conduit fill to ensure that the wire size is adequate for the specific application.
8. Compliance with Electrical Codes
Electrical codes, such as the National Electric Code (NEC), provide guidelines for wire sizing to ensure safety and prevent electrical hazards. The wire sizing chart must comply with these codes to guarantee a safe and efficient electrical circuit. It is essential to consult the relevant electrical codes when selecting a wire size.
9. Derating Factors
Derating factors, such as the number of wires in a bundle and the ambient temperature, affect the wire sizing chart. These factors reduce the wire's ampacity, requiring larger wire sizes to compensate. The wire sizing chart takes into account derating factors to provide the recommended wire size.
10. Verification and Validation
It is crucial to verify and validate the wire sizing chart to ensure that it is accurate and applicable to your specific electrical project. Consulting with electrical engineers and experts can help you confirm that the wire size meets the requirements and complies with electrical codes and regulations.
